Loose nut

Sign in to disble this ad
While I was changing strings, I realized the nut was loose. It slid out sideways. It stays in place while it's strung, but it gets slippery without the strings. What type of glue should I use to put it back in, and where can I get it? It is a bone nut, and the neck is maple. Thanks for the help.

Just a spot of superglue will hold it and allow it still to be knocked out if you ever need to remove it.
